Are you excelling in a subject and interested in becoming a peer coach?

Peer coaches are a critical resource for the Kelley and IU Bloomington community. As a coach, you will not only support students academically and work closely with Kelley faculty and staff, but also develop your communication, mentoring, and leadership abilities—qualities indispensable to many firms.

If you excelled in one of the courses offered by ASK, are reliable and passionate about helping others, and can commit to five hours a week of coaching, consider applying for a peer coaching position.

 Benefits:

  • Receive compensation—$10.15 an hour
  • Get professional and leadership development
  • Build deeper relationships with faculty, staff, and peers
  • Give back to the Kelley community

Eligibility:

  • Earn an A- or higher in any course listed above
  • Have a 3.3 cumulative GPA
  • Pass the technical exam
  • Pass the behavioral interview
  • Complete the HR paperwork process upon offer
  • Receive priority status for those who can coach multiple courses

 Expectations:

  • Attend all trainings
  • Complete a minimum of 5 coaching hours per week, per course
  • Communicate openly with program staff
